Q1. [1]
A wire of length 'l' is gradually stretched so that its length increases to 3l. If its original resistance is R, then its new resistance will be :
  1. (A) 3R
  2. (B) 6R
  3. (C) 9R
  4. (D) 27R

Model Answer

(C) 9R

When length becomes 3l, volume is conserved, so area becomes A/3. New resistance = ρ(3l)/(A/3) = 9(ρl/A) = 9R.

Explanation

Key concept: Volume of wire is conserved during stretching (V = A·l = constant).
